About This Food Place
Il Miracolo is a laid-back pizza spot right in the heart of Napoli where you can enjoy everything from a quick bite to a relaxed dinner. The menu leans on fresh, simple ingredients with options that cater to healthy eaters as well as those craving traditional flavors. Whether you’re dining solo or with a group, there’s a comfortable seat for you, including outdoor seating when the weather’s nice. The vibe is casual and a bit trendy without being too loud, making it easy to enjoy a coffee or a glass of wine while you take your time. Wheelchair access and family-friendly options round out a place that feels welcoming to pretty much everyone.

Carrie Ho
My food was pretty good. The gluten free pizza tasted as good as the gluten one. I would appreciate a little more toppings. The octopus salad was good. I wouldn’t recommend the seaweed balls though. There’s barely any seaweed and it tasted doughy. Service was fast and courteous. I enjoyed it there.

Sofia
The service improves a bit if you speak Italian, but it was good overall. We ordered a fried pizza. The prices are very reasonable considering the quantity and quality of the food. As in most of Italy (if I'm not mistaken), they charge for service or tableware when dining inside without asking first — it was €3, so it’s good to keep that in mind when deciding to eat indoors.
